启动图像无效。未针对 iPhone 5 优化

Posted

技术标签:

【中文标题】启动图像无效。未针对 iPhone 5 优化【英文标题】:Invalid Launch Image. Not Optimized for iPhone 5 【发布时间】:2014-10-07 14:52:07 【问题描述】:

我的应用程序加载器要求我针对 iPhone 5 进行优化。但事实是......

    我确实有 Default-568h@2x.png 启动图像 我的应用(游戏)的所有屏幕都满足 iPhone 5 的屏幕尺寸要求

但我仍然收到这个没有意义的错误。以下是我这边的图片



以下是我正在使用的启动图像名称/大小...

默认-568h@2x (640x1136)

默认-667h@2x (750x1334)

默认-736h@3x (1242x208)

默认 (320x480)

默认@2x (640x960)

P.S:我的应用程序(游戏)仅是纵向的。我支持 iPhone 3G 到 iPhone 6/6+

【问题讨论】:

为什么不确保所有这些启动图像都已填满。如果您不想复制启动图像,只需更新相应的 Contents.json 文件以指向正确的图像。 【参考方案1】:

使用资产的名称作为

默认.png 默认@2x.png 默认@3x.png 1x 资产适用于 iPhone 2G、3g、3GS。 iPhone 4,4S,5,5S,5C,6,6S 的 2x 资源 iPhone 6 Plus、6S Plus 的 3 倍资产。

【讨论】:

以上是关于启动图像无效。未针对 iPhone 5 优化的主要内容,如果未能解决你的问题,请参考以下文章

iPhone 5 优化要求 - 启动图像真的有必要吗?

我的二进制文件没有针对 iPhone 5 进行优化,同时具有本地化的启动画面

由于启动图像,App Store 应用程序提交 xcode 4.2 失败

您的二进制文件未针对 iPhone 5 xcassets 进行优化

无法将应用程序提交到 iTunes,二进制文件未针对 iPhone 5 进行优化 错误

图片路径无效 - 未找到图片